Sam Kerr’s sizzling snap with new girlfriend sets tongues wagging

Australian football superstar Sam Kerr and her new girlfriend have sent social media into meltdown with a sizzling poolside snap.

US footballer Kristie Mewis posted an image to Instagram of the powerhouse couple sharing a passionate kiss while floating on an inflatable pool toy.

The photo was captioned “kerrching” and quickly accumulated over 65,000 likes and 1110 comments within hours of being posted.

Former American footballer Stephanie McCaffrey and current-day star Megan Rapinoe were among those to comment on the photo and give it their tick of approval.

After weeks of speculation, Kerr confirmed she was dating Mewis by uploading a photo of the pair to Instagram earlier this month.

Mewis also went public with their relationship, sharing a selfie of the couple pressing their heads together to the social media platform.

Speculation the pair was dating went into overdrive when they were seen cuddling on the pitch following the bronze medal match at the Tokyo Olympics, which the United States won 4-3 against Australia.

Kerr represents Chelsea in the Women’s Super League in England while Mewis plays for the Houston Dash in America’s National Women’s Soccer League.

Kerr separated from long-term partner Nikki Stanton ahead of the Tokyo Games after more than seven years together.

The 27-year-old reportedly told friends she had “fallen out of love” with Stanton, whom she met back in 2014.

Kerr became the Matildas’ leading goalscorer during the bronze medal match in Japan, with her 48th international goal putting her ahead of Lisa De Vanna on the all-time list.

She scored a total of six goals across six matches in Tokyo.
